As some of you know ( and some of you may not ) my 16yo son, Seth, is an actor. Has been since the 4th grade. For those of you with kids, and are fortunate enough to have teachers that really care about their students.....listen to them.

He's auditioned for many roles, scored one in an indie movie (http://bigbendmovie.com/) that fell apart over financials, etc. Late last year, he was asked to put something on tape for Disney. We did....and didn't hear back until late Dec. His DFW agent told us we had to be in Austin in January for a callback. He nailed the part, and we stayed for a week so he could rehearse and film two episodes. A few months later, we were called to go back to Austin for two weeks to film 13 more episodes.

It's an interstitial ( short, 3-5 minute episodes ) called, "As The Bell Rings". It's a lower budget Disney production, shot with a single camera, few angles, filmed thru a window ( prop ), with 6 kids, about the stuff that goes on between classes in school. Based on a Italian Disney project called "Quelli dell'Intervallo". It's done well in Italy, well in Spain, Austrailia, but bombed in the UK because they changed the formula ( please discount all reviews of the UK project ). It's been advertised on The Hollywood Reporter, Variety, and a many others.

During the premier of High School Musical 2 over a week ago, they started showing promos of the show. They've been on all week long.
